NPN SILICON ANNULAR TRANSISTORS
. . . designed for audio amplifier applications.
• DC Current Gain Specified for Audio Predriver Design -
100 MAdc to 10 mAdc for MPS6573 and MPS6575
• DC Current Gain to Facilitate Differential Amplifier
Design for Audio Input Stages —
Grouping at 1.0 mAdc for MPS6574 and MPS6576
• Current-Gain - Bandwidth Product —
fr - 200 MHz (Max) for Audio Frequency Design
